One of the most groundbreaking aspects of PSP games was their narrative depth. Titles like Final Fantasy VII: Crisis Core and Metal Gear Solid: Peace Walker weren’t just side stories—they were crucial chapters in beloved franchises. These games featured full voice acting, cinematic cutscenes, and complex gameplay systems, all within the limits of a portable device. They proved that players didn’t have to sacrifice story for portability.

Moreover, the PSP hosted a strong catalog of original IPs that experimented with mechanics and genres. Patapon combined rhythm with real-time strategy, challenging players to lead tribal warriors through chants and beats. LocoRoco used tilt mechanics and physics-based puzzles to deliver an experience that felt joyful and tactile. These were games that couldn’t have existed anywhere else at the time.

Multiplayer was another arena where PSP games quietly innovated. Local wireless play in Monster Hunter built a culture of co-op hunting long before it became a mainstream feature in Western markets. This social aspect of handheld gaming paved the way for today’s portable multiplayer titles. In many ways, the PSP was the blueprint for the fusion of depth and mobility that defines today’s handheld scene.

Best Games on PlayStation That Redefined Genres

PlayStation has long been a breeding ground for genre-defining titles, with some of the best games not just excelling in their categories but fundamentally reshaping them. These games brought fresh ideas and refined mechanics that influenced countless successors and expanded what players expected from their gaming experiences.

One landmark title is Shadow of the Colossus, which redefined the action-adventure genre by focusing entirely on epic mudah4d battles against giant creatures rather than traditional enemy encounters. Its minimalist design and emotional depth created a haunting atmosphere that felt unlike anything before, inspiring developers to explore storytelling through gameplay in more abstract, artistic ways.

Another genre-redefining game is Bloodborne, which took the formula of the challenging “Souls-like” games and infused it with a faster, more aggressive combat style and a dark, Lovecraftian setting. It refined the punishing gameplay loop into something deeply rewarding and accessible for players willing to embrace its challenge, influencing action RPGs broadly.

On the lighter side, LittleBigPlanet revolutionized platformers by integrating player creativity through level creation and sharing. It turned a genre often centered on fixed stages into a community-driven playground, fostering user-generated content long before it became mainstream.
